Output e92f670e1798aeceb6bdd7c406c0251fd7753aac81f9783483630fc5f5cf1894:2

value
22539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2dbfe1dcc1c541cdf324aacb76fad04fe560cb7 OP_EQUAL
address
3Pq8zKiPJhZxRCeoeaquaHbmAn26YJ1HfJ
transaction
e92f670e1798aeceb6bdd7c406c0251fd7753aac81f9783483630fc5f5cf1894
confirmations
154595
spent
true